LOT 1375 - 1953 Kindig CF1 Barrett-Jackson Edition Custom Roadster. This unique and collectible 1953 ‪@KindigitDesign‬ CF1 Roadster is a Barrett-Jackson Licensed Edition featuring a carbon-fiber body sitting on a custom chassis. Number 8 of a limited production, this Roadster sold for $572,000 at the 2023 Scottsdale Auction.
